The street in brief

The Close is a mix of semi-detached houses and terraced houses. Sales here are sparse and mostly older — the last recorded sale was in 2011, so today's values are best judged from the wider SP5 figures below.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; SP5 prices as a whole have been easing. HM Land Registry records 6 sales across 5 homes since 1995 — homes here come up rarely.
